If you’re not quite sure about what these two file types are, here’s a quick refresher.

PDF files are supported by Adobe, and they are useful in many types of work applications because unless you have an Adobe editor, they are unchangeable files. JPG files are image files that are commonly re-formatted in order to compress them to save on storage space. Websites must constantly be aware of the loading speed for images, so JPG files will often be compressed in the interest of faster loading.
